With VoIP telephone services, local and long distance calls cost about the same because the calls are fed through the internet. Instead of having to pay extra charges for out of state and country calls, Pop VoIP provides long distance telephone service for low flat rates.

PopVoIP.com offers a number of hosted VoIP telephone plans for small businesses, eliminating the high cost of traditional telecommunication services. A standard PBX system requires large, expensive equipment, and multiple phone lines to function, which can eat into a small business' budget. Pop VoiP's hosted PBX system offers a cleaner, more efficient alternative.  

The hosted PBX system operates through the internet, which means that there is no need for multiple phone lines. With online access, employees may log in and communicate through the hosted PBX system on any computer. And, unlike conventional PBX systems, employees may stay connected to their VoIP networks as long as they have access to the internet. This is great for companies with traveling employees or multiple branches. A VoIP hosted PBX system can also streamline digital communication with convenient features like online faxing.
